Repository URL to install this package:
|
Version:
2.1.6 ▾
|
import { styled } from 'styleh-components'
import { StyledBaseText } from '@skava/ui/dist/components/atoms/Text'
const StyledText = StyledBaseText.as('span')
const StyledDetails = styled(StyledText) `
text-transform: capitalize;
color: var(--color-black);
font-size: 1rem;
@tablet-or-smaller() {
font-size: 1rem;
}
`
const StyledTeamText = styled(StyledDetails).attrs({
'data-qa': 'qa-user-team',
}) ``
const StyledRoleText = styled(StyledDetails).attrs({
'data-qa': 'qa-user-role',
}) ``
const StyledStatus = styled(StyledText) `
text-transform: capitalize;
color: ${props => props.color};
font-size: 1rem;
padding-top: 5px;
@tablet-or-smaller() {
font-size: rem(18);
}
`
const StyledSeparator = styled.span `
margin: 0 5px;
`
const StyledEmail = styled(StyledText) `
color: var(--color-black);
font-size: 1rem;
@tablet-or-smaller() {
font-size: 1rem;
}
`
const StyledIdentifier = styled(StyledText) `
&:first-child {
margin-right: rem(4);
text-transform: uppercase;
}
color: var(--color-black);
font-size: 1rem;
@tablet-or-smaller() {
font-size: 1rem;
}
`
const StyledName = styled(StyledText).attrs({
'data-qa': 'qa-user-name',
}) `
font-weight: 700;
color: var(--color-black);
font-size: 1rem;
text-transform: capitalize;
`
export {
StyledDetails,
StyledStatus,
StyledSeparator,
StyledEmail,
StyledTeamText,
StyledRoleText,
StyledIdentifier,
StyledName,
}